Skip to content

A project in which you can be able to push a button to send a signal to the police and an alcohol sensor so you can send a message to one familiar

Notifications You must be signed in to change notification settings

dmtzs/panic-button-sensor

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

54 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

cover-image

MQTT messages

Panic button and Alcohol message

GitHub top language

GitHub repo size Lines of code GitHub language count

Description

A project in which Im going to build a panic button that can send an email or telegram maybe with the location of the one that push the button. Another part too with an alcohol sensor that will do the same but this is going to be in the case that you are drunk.

Documentation

I´m developing a github page in the wiki part in order to use that space as a documentation, that documentation is still in development but is going to be there. Click here in order to go to that documentation page.
Also please see below the list of the hardware which are going to be used in this project.

Supported versions for releases

To see the releases supported versions please click here to see the supported ones and unsupported ones.

ESP32-program

Specifications

Lambda-program

Specifications

sensors-and-materials-list-used

  • MQ-3 sensor
  • NEO 6M GPS module
  • ESP32
  • Lipo battery
  • TP4056 module
  • Step up voltage module
  • Push buttons
  • Buzzer

connection-diagram

Connection diagram

Tasks to do

The tasks described below are linked to an issue that also appears in the section of projects of the present github project. What you see below is a resume of some of the issues opened but are not all of them, only the main functionalities.

The nomenclature is the next one:

✅: Done ❌: Not done yet

For the sensors:

  • ✅ MQ-3
  • ✅ GPS
  • ❌ Push button lecture
  • ❌ Set both together

For the MQTT

  • ❌ Send coordinates to google iot core MQTT
  • ❌ Add register to firebase

Personal notes

Necesite descargar la biblioteca desde el release de su github e instalarla con el siguiente comando posicionandome sobre la ruta de donde se descrago la biblioteca:

python -m pip install .\Flask-GoogleMaps-4.1.1.2.tar.gz

El release puede ser encontrado dando clic aquí y usando el más reciente

También a pesar de eso se presentaron unos errores, usar el init del repo dando clic aquí

About

A project in which you can be able to push a button to send a signal to the police and an alcohol sensor so you can send a message to one familiar

Topics

Resources

Security policy

Stars

Watchers

Forks